/// <summary> /// 重新绑定一个用来输出的MatchInfo /// </summary> /// <param name="matchInfo"></param> public void RebindMatchInfo(MatchInfo matchInfo) { OutputMatchInfo = matchInfo; }
public ObjectManager(MatchInfo matchInfo) { RebindMatchInfo(matchInfo); RebindObject(); }
public RecordData(DataType type, MatchInfo matchInfo) { this.type = type; this.matchInfo = matchInfo; }
/// <summary> /// 将场地设置为默认 /// </summary> public void SetToDefault() { RevertScene(MatchInfo.NewDefaultPreset()); }
public static void RefreshToScene(MatchInfo matchInfo) { SetBallPlacement(matchInfo.CurrentBall); SetBluePlacement(matchInfo.BlueRobot); SetYellowPlacement(matchInfo.YellowRobot); }